  1. RFI Title: Indefinite Delivery Indefinite Quantity (IDIQ) supplies for Vitros 7600 chemistry and immunochemistry analyzers for the Defense Health Agency (DHA) Medical Treatment Facility (MTF) in Sicily (Italy).

  2. LOCATION: U.S. NMRTC Sigonella – NAS , Strada Statale 192 KM 15, Catania-Enna, Sigonella, Sicily (Italy)

  3. BACKGROUND: The U.S. Naval Hospital Sigonella Laboratory Department requires an IDIQ contract to provide materials necessary for two Vitros 7600 chemistry and immunochemistry analyzers. These supplies are used to perform critical care testing including cardiac markers, liver enzymes, kidney function and BHCG testing needed for emergent patient care and essential to hospital operation. Given the critical nature of the testing performed and that the products required strict temperature control, supplies must be delivered within four (4) days of order placement and must be received at necessary temperatures listed within the Statement of Work. (SOW)

  4. DESCRIPTION: NAICS 334516 - Analytical Laboratory Instrument Manufacturing, PSC 6550 - In vitro diagnostic substances, reagents, test kits and sets. See DRAFT Statement of Work (SOW).
